Step1: Recall the formula for the area of a triangle
The formula for the area of a triangle when two sides \(a\), \(b\) and the included angle \(C\) are known is \(A=\frac{1}{2}ab\sin C\).
Step2: Substitute the given values into the formula
Given \(a = 11.54\), \(b=6.15\), and \(C = 13.37^{\circ}\). First, find \(\sin(13.37^{\circ})\). Using a calculator, \(\sin(13.37^{\circ})\approx0.231\). Then substitute into the formula:
